We live in a nation that is part Jeffersonian and part Hamiltonian. From the aristocratic Jefferson we cherish liberty, equality, democracy and the importance of the ability of the average person to fully participate in government. Hamilton’s vision for the American economy was one of capitalism, and he did much to lay the foundation for it. In this course, we will explore the differences between these two giants of the founding generation and how this led to the birth of the American two-party system.
